Bringing all forms and genres of music together into one big celebration, iHeartRadio just announced their 2018 lineup for their massive Vegas music festival held later this year.

Country music will show off the best of the best from the format by sending out a few artists to the Sin City landscape for hot performances to keep the party going. Carrie Underwood, Jason Aldean and Luke Bryan will represent country on the big stage over the two-day event, with Dustin Lynch and Bobby Bones and the Raging Idiots playing on the Daytime Stage on the second day.

Other featured names jetting off to Vegas to perform live include Justin Timberlake, Kelly Clarkson, Imagine Dragons, Mariah Carey, Lynyrd Skynyrd, Shawn Mendes, Jack White, Sam Smith among many talented artists to name a few. For the daytime shows, iHeartRadio booked 5 Seconds of Summer, Bazzi, Dua Lipa, Logic and more.

For those who can’t make it out to the festival in live time, the CW partners with iHeartRadio to live stream all the action through the network’s website. They also plan to produce a television special of all the exciting on-stage moments to air on the nights of October 7 and 8.

The iHeartRadio Music Festival 2018 will be held at the T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as on September 21 and 22. Tickets go on sale to the public on Friday, June 15, at 10 a.m. PST.
